Hunter Young compares the key clashes as Crystal Palace begin their tough run-in with a home match against Manchester City.

One of the shock results of the season was the Eagles' victory over Manchester City at the Etihad in December. That loss marked a low point for the Citizens' from which they have since bounced back and sit two points behind Liverpool for the league title. Palace's win over Newcastle virtually wrapped up safety and leaves them 11 points above the drop. Sergio Aguero v Scott Dann

The title race is not the only one in full swing with Sergio Aguero currently leading the charge in the challenge for the Golden Boot. The Argentine has scored 19 goals in the Premier League this term but will have to continue his good form if he is to hold off challenges from the likes of Mohammad Salah and Harry Kane, among others.

The sight of James Tomkins limping off the pitch last week is far from an ideal one and he will be joining Mamadou Sakho on the sidelines for the foreseeable future. Unless Roy Hodgson decides to give Sam Woods a chance, Scott Dann will replace Tomkins in the starting 11. The experienced defender and former captain will be determined to seize this opportunity, but there are fewer tougher challenges than Aguero.

Fernandinho v Luka Milivojevic

Fernandinho missed the December clash between these two teams and his presence on the field was greatly missed. The Brazilian shields the defence and controls the midfield like few in the world. The key to breaking down the resolute Man City back line is getting past Fernandinho, a task that is much easier said than done.

Luka Milivojevic is in position to match a Premier League record for penalties scored in a season, should he score one more this campaign. The Serb has scored 10 of his 11 goals from the spot and is one of the best in the world when the pressure is on. The defensive midfielder will have to be on his game from more than the spot if he wants to limit Fernandinho’s influence on the match.

Raheem Sterling v Aaron Wan-Bissaka

Aguero is not the only member of City's squad racking up the goals this season. Speedy English winger Raheem Sterling has scored 15 goals. Either Sterling or Sane will likely start the game on the left and either will provide a tough task for Palace starlet Aaron Wan-Bissaka.

Wan-Bissaka racked up yet another player of the month award for March, his fourth of the season. The rising star has been linked with moves to many of England’s big clubs, with Manchester City being chief among potential suitors. Putting an in impressive performance against Sterling could entice Pep Guardiola into making a summer move for the outstanding young defender.
